在当今数字化时代,网站和应用程序(APP)的安全性至关重要。随着技术的进步,网络攻击也变得更加复杂,因此开发者需要采用多层防护策略来确保用户数据的安全性和隐私。以下是一些网站和APP开发过程中最应该重视的安全措施。
1. 数据加密
无论是传输中的数据还是存储的数据,都应当进行加密处理,以防止信息泄露。例如,在传输敏感信息时,可以使用SSL/TLS协议;而对数据库中的密码等重要信息,则应采用哈希算法进行不可逆加密。
2. 安全身份验证与访问控制
为每个用户提供唯一的账户,并要求设置强密码。同时实施多因素认证(MFA),如短信验证码、指纹识别等方式增强安全性。根据用户角色分配不同的权限级别,限制其可操作范围。
3. 输入验证
对于所有来自用户的输入内容都要经过严格的检查和过滤,避免SQL注入、XSS跨站脚本攻击等问题。这包括但不限于表单提交、URL参数以及API请求等。
4. 定期更新与漏洞修补
及时安装官方发布的安全补丁,修复已知的安全漏洞。定期审查代码库,查找潜在风险点并加以改进。还可以考虑加入自动化测试工具,持续监控系统状态。
5. 日志记录与监控
详细记录服务器端发生的各种事件,包括登录尝试、文件上传下载等活动。通过分析日志文件能够快速定位异常行为,帮助管理员做出正确决策。部署专业的安全监测设备或服务,实时掌握平台运行状况。
6. 遵循最佳实践指南
参考OWASP(开放Web应用安全项目)等权威组织发布的建议,了解当前流行的攻击手段及防御方法。积极参加相关培训课程,提高团队成员的安全意识和技术水平。
7. 用户教育
除了技术层面的防护之外,还需要加强对最终用户的指导。告知他们如何保护个人信息,警惕钓鱼邮件和社会工程学骗局。鼓励大家养成良好的上网习惯,共同维护网络安全环境。
文章推荐更多>
- 1微软 Win11 原生邮件和日历已无法同步 Outlook、Hotmail 账号:
- 2oracle误删数据怎么恢复
- 3uc浏览器怎么退出登录账号 uc账号安全退出操作指南
- 4uc浏览器已缓存的视频怎么导出
- 5夸克浏览器怎么找资源的步骤 夸克浏览器资源搜索技巧分享
- 6wordpress手机插件怎么使用
- 7🚀拖拽式CMS建站能否实现高效与个性化并存?
- 8笔记本电脑全黑屏只剩鼠标 笔记本黑屏鼠标可见处理方法大全
- 9phpmyadmin建表是要求非空怎么处理
- 10oracle闪回一个星期前的数据怎么删除
- 11UC缓存m3u8转MP4教程
- 12dedecms系统怎么用
- 13手机UC视频转存到U盘
- 14phpmyadminv3.5.2.2的漏洞编号是什么
- 15AO3怎么进入 现在a03怎么进入2025
- 16wordpress插件如何实现链接跳转
- 17oracle数据库闪回功能怎么使用
- 18c盘空间为0怎么办 恢复c盘可用空间的4个步骤
- 19 微信h5制作网站有哪些,免费微信H5页面制作工具?
- 20 手机网站制作与建设方案,手机网站如何建设?
- 21笔记本电脑怎么开机 笔记本开机步骤及注意事项
- 22wordpress是什么框架
- 23wordpress底部版权怎么修改
- 24夸克怎么免费解压视频 视频解压操作指南
- 25多台电脑批量定时关机:局域网环境下的组策略管理
- 26笔记本电脑开不了机 笔记本无法开机故障排查
- 27UC缓存m3u8合并转换工具
- 28phpmyadmin怎么添加数据
- 29uc浏览器缓存的视频怎么导出到电脑
- 30oracle delete删除的数据怎么恢复
